Поделиться через


Сколько принтеров может поддерживать корпорация Майкрософт коннектор универсальной печати?

Количество принтеров, которые может поддерживать Подключение or, зависит от спецификаций компьютера, на котором он работает. Это рекомендации по максимальному количеству принтеров, которые могут быть зарегистрированы в 2 разных размерах виртуальных машин Azure, каждый из которых работает под управлением Центра обработки данных Windows Server 2019 (1809):

Размер виртуальной машины Azure Рекомендуемое максимальное количество зарегистрированных принтеров Время, затраченное на инициализацию принтеров после перезапуска службы печати Подключение or Service Время перечисления принтеров в приложении "Печать Подключение or"
Виртуальная машина Azure Standard_B2s (2 виртуальных ЦП, 4 ГБ ОЗУ) 150 6 мин. 10 seconds
Виртуальная машина Azure Standard_B2ms (2vCPUs, 8 ГБ ОЗУ) 600 20 минут. 40 секунд


Все приведенные выше числа — это оценки на основе типичного использования. У каждого клиента будет уникальная настройка, которая повлияет на объем нагрузки на Подключение or. Следующая настройка использовалась в тестовой среде:

  • Мы убедились, что Подключение ор был способен обрабатывать задания печати, отправляемые по более высокой частоте. В общей сложности 1200 заданий типичных размеров были отправлены в Подключение or более 90 минут, и каждое задание было отправлено случайным образом на один из зарегистрированных принтеров. Это привело к тому, что около 4 принтеров одновременно обрабатывают задания в любое время.
    • Другие настройки могут не достичь этого уровня пропускной способности задания. Например, снижение пропускной способности сети или более крупные размеры заданий могут препятствовать быстрому скачиванию заданий Подключение, что приводит к снижению времени печати и снижению пропускной способности.
    • Обратите внимание, что принтеры, зарегистрированные в Подключение or, будут обрабатывать только 1 задание за раз. Если несколько заданий отправляются на один принтер, остальные задания будут ожидать завершения первого задания. Если задания отправляются на несколько принтеров, каждый принтер будет обрабатывать 1 задание за раз, но они будут делать это параллельно. В будущей документации будет описано максимальное количество принтеров, которые можно печатать параллельно до замедления обработки заданий печати.
  • Все регистрации принтера были завершены перед отправкой заданий печати в них.
  • Принтеры были созданы с помощью выбора часто используемых драйверов от нескольких производителей, чтобы обеспечить реалистичное использование ресурсов. Это были "виртуальные" принтеры, которые печатались в файлах вместо производства физических выходных данных.
  • Виртуальные машины не использовались для других рабочих нагрузок, кроме запуска Подключение or. Кроме драйверов принтера не было установлено дополнительное программное обеспечение печати. Если установлено программное обеспечение печати, которое выполняет дополнительную обработку заданий печати, это уменьшит количество поддерживаемых регистраций принтеров.


В этих условиях основной фактор, влияющий на количество принтеров, которые могут быть зарегистрированы, — это объем памяти, доступный на компьютере. Использование памяти увеличилось примерно на 700 МБ для каждых 100 зарегистрированных принтеров. Помимо этого, отправка заданий с частотой 800 заданий в час привела к увеличению использования памяти примерно на 700 МБ. При установке приведенных выше рекомендаций мы стремимся сохранить общее использование памяти системы ниже 90% от общего объема памяти виртуальной машины.


Мы рекомендуем клиентам следовать этому процессу при регистрации большого количества принтеров с помощью Подключение or:

  1. Проверьте общее использование памяти компьютера до регистрации любых принтеров и используйте приведенные выше цифры, чтобы оценить, сколько принтеров можно безопасно зарегистрировать.
  2. После регистрации всех принтеров перезапустите службу "Печать Подключение or" и отслеживайте использование памяти. Для виртуальных машин Azure это можно сделать на странице метрик на виртуальной машине на портале Azure. Без заданий печати максимальное использование памяти службы происходит во время перезапуска при инициализации всех принтеров.
  3. Продолжайте отслеживать использование памяти после обычной загрузки принтеров.


Если компьютер не хватает памяти, Подключение or больше не сможет печатать задания надежно. Если использование памяти наблюдается на 90 % или больше, рекомендуется выполнить одно из следующих действий:

  • Увеличьте объем памяти на компьютере или
  • Установите и повторно зарегистрируйте некоторые принтеры на Подключение or, работающем на другом компьютере, используйте переключение принтера для перемещения общих папок принтера на недавно зарегистрированные принтеры, а затем отмените регистрацию и удаление этих принтеров с старого компьютера Подключение or.